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Seafood Lasagna with Lobster and Shrimp

Step 1: Sauté the Aromatics
He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Once the oil shimmers, add 1 finely chopped onion and sauté for 5 minutes until it becomes translucent. Stir occasionally to avoid browning, ensuring a sweet base flavor for your Seafood Lasagna with Lobster and Shrimp.

Step 2: Add Garlic and Herbs
Next, incorporate 3 minced garlic cloves into the skillet, cooking for an additional minute until fragrant. Immediately add 1 teaspoon of dried oregano and 1 teaspoon of dried basil, followed by a pinch of red pepper flakes for a hint of heat. This aromatic combination will elevate your sauce beautifully.

Step 3: Deglaze with White Wine
Pour in 1 cup of white wine, stirring to deglaze the pan. Allow the mixture to simmer for 3-4 minutes until reduced by half, concentrating the flavors. You’ll notice a lovely aroma wafting up, signaling that your base is coming together for the lasagna.

Step 4: Create the Creamy Sauce
Reduce heat to low, and stir in 1 cup of heavy cream. Let it simmer gently for 5 minutes, stirring occasionally until slightly thickened. The sauce should have a luxurious texture, ready to envelop the seafood in the Seafood Lasagna with Lobster and Shrimp.

Step 5: Incorporate the Seafood
Add 1 cup of cooked lobster meat and 1 cup of shrimp to the sauce, heating through for about 3 minutes. Stir gently to coat the seafood in the creamy mixture, then season with salt and black pepper to taste. The seafood should be warm and perfectly nestled in the sauce.

Step 6: Preheat the Oven
While your seafood mixture simmers, pre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). This ensures the ideal baking temperature as you prepare the lasagna layers, creating that golden, bubbly top everyone loves.

Step 7: Assemble the Lasagna
Butter a 9×13-inch baking dish and layer three lasagna noodles on the bottom. Spoon a generous portion of the seafood mixture over the noodles, followed by dollops of ricotta and a sprinkle of mozzarella cheese. This will be the foundation of your indulgent Seafood Lasagna with Lobster and Shrimp.

Step 8: Repeat Layering
Continue layering by adding three more lasagna noodles, more seafood mixture, ricotta, and mozzarella, repeating two more times. Finish with the remaining seafood mixture on top. This layering technique ensures each slice is packed with flavor and creaminess.

Step 9: Final Touches
Top the final layer with the remaining mozzarella cheese and a generous sprinkle of grated Parmesan cheese for added depth. You can also garnish it with fresh parsley for a pop of color. Make sure everything is evenly distributed for a delicious result.

Step 10: Bake the Lasagna
Cover the dish tightly with aluminum foil and bake in the preheated oven for 25 minutes. The foil helps steam the lasagna, allowing flavors to meld beautifully, setting the stage for an unforgettable meal.

Step 11: Finish Baking Uncovered
After 25 minutes, carefully remove the foil and bake for another 10 minutes until the top is golden and bubbly. Watch for that beautiful crisp, as it indicates your Seafood Lasagna with Lobster and Shrimp is almost ready!

Step 12: Let it Rest
Once out of the oven, allow the lasagna to rest for 10 minutes. This wait time is essential for the layers to set, making slicing easier. Enjoy the anticipation of sharing a comforting dish that is truly a showstopper!

How to Store and Freeze Seafood Lasagna

Fridge: Store leftover seafood lasagna in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Make sure it is completely cooled before sealing to retain its texture and flavor.

Freezer: Freeze the lasagna in a tightly sealed container or heavy-duty freezer bag for up to 3 months. For best results, wrap it in plastic wrap before placing it in the container.

Reheating: Reheat slices of the seafood lasagna covered in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 20-25 minutes, or until warmed through. This helps to maintain the creamy texture without drying it out.

Thawing: If frozen, allow your seafood lasagna to thaw in the refrigerator overnight before reheating for the most enjoyable meal experience.

Expert Tips for Seafood Lasagna

  • Cook Seafood First: Ensure the lobster and shrimp are cooked through before adding them to the sauce. This prevents overcooking during baking, keeping them tender in your Seafood Lasagna with Lobster and Shrimp.

  • Layer with Care: When assembling, distribute the seafood mixture evenly to avoid overly dry or saucy bites. Each slice should be a perfect balance of flavors.

  • Let it Rest: After baking, allow the lasagna to rest for 10 minutes. This crucial step helps maintain the layers, making it easier to slice without falling apart.

  • Adjust Seasoning Wisely: Remember that added seafood can increase the saltiness. Adjust your seasoning after incorporating it into the sauce for the best flavor.

  • Be Mindful of Heat: If you’re sensitive to spice, reduce or omit the red pepper flakes. You can always add crushed red pepper at the table for those who enjoy it!

Make Ahead Options

These indulgent Seafood Lasagna with Lobster and Shrimp are perfect for busy home cooks looking to save time! You can prepare the entire lasagna and refrigerate it up to 24 hours in advance before baking. Simply follow the layering instructions and cover the dish tightly with foil to maintain freshness. If you prefer to prep the seafood mixture separately, you can refrigerate it for up to 3 days, just remember to reheat it gently before assembling. When you’re ready to serve, pop the lasagna in the oven directly from the fridge, adding an extra 10-15 minutes to the baking time. Ingredients
  

For the Sauce
  • 2 tablespoons Olive Oil Substitute with avocado oil for a neutral flavor.
  • 1 medium Onion Shallots can be used for a milder taste.
  • 3 cloves Garlic Use garlic powder in smaller amounts if fresh is unavailable.
  • 1 teaspoon Dried Oregano Dried Italian seasoning or thyme works as a substitute.
  • 1 teaspoon Dried Basil Fresh basil can be used but add more since it’s less concentrated.
  • 1 pinch Red Pepper Flakes Omit for a milder flavor profile.
  • 1 cup White Wine Use chicken or vegetable broth for a non-alcoholic option.
  • 1 cup Heavy Cream Swap with half-and-half for a lighter option.
For the Seafood
  • 1 cup Lobster Meat Crab meat or mixed seafood can be used as desired.
  • 1 cup Shrimp Consider scallops or additional lobster as substitutes.
For Assembly
  • 9 slices Lasagna Noodles No-boil noodles can be used by adding extra sauce.
  • 1 cup Ricotta Cheese Cottage cheese or mascarpone work as alternatives.
  • 2 cups Mozzarella Cheese Provolone or Monterey Jack are good substitutes.
  • 0.5 cup Parmesan Cheese Use Pecorino Romano for a sharper flavor.
  • 0.25 cup Fresh Parsley Substitute with basil or chives for a different flavor.
  • to taste Salt Essential for seasoning; adjust to your taste.
  • to taste Black Pepper Essential for seasoning; adjust to your taste.

Equipment

  • Large Skillet
  • 9x13 inch baking dish
  • Oven

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Step 1: Sauté the Aromatics -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add finely chopped onion and sauté for 5 minutes until translucent.
  2. Step 2: Add Garlic and Herbs - Incorporate minced garlic, dried oregano, dried basil, and a pinch of red pepper flakes; cook for an additional minute until fragrant.
  3. Step 3: Deglaze with White Wine - Pour in white wine, stirring to deglaze the pan. Simmer for 3-4 minutes until reduced by half.
  4. Step 4: Create the Creamy Sauce - Stir in heavy cream; let it simmer for 5 minutes until slightly thickened.
  5. Step 5: Incorporate the Seafood - Add cooked lobster meat and shrimp, heat through for about 3 minutes. Season with salt and black pepper to taste.
  6. Step 6: Preheat the Oven -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
  7. Step 7: Assemble the Lasagna - Butter a baking dish and layer noodles, seafood mixture, ricotta, and mozzarella.
  8. Step 8: Repeat Layering - Add more layers of noodles, seafood mixture, ricotta, and mozzarella for two more times.
  9. Step 9: Final Touches - Top with remaining mozzarella and Parmesan cheese; garnish with parsley.
  10. Step 10: Bake the Lasagna - Cover with foil and bake for 25 minutes.
  11. Step 11: Finish Baking Uncovered - Remove foil and bake for another 10 minutes until golden and bubbly.
  12. Step 12: Let it Rest - Allow the lasagna to rest for 10 minutes before serving.
